We are looking for an Enterprise Security Services Lead to oversee and coordinate security across our enterprise infrastructure, applications, and third-party ecosystem. You will drive vulnerability management across servers, endpoints, networks, and applications, while ensuring our technology environment meets AutoStore security standards and follows security best practices.

The role also covers application and third-party security, working with internal teams and external service providers to strengthen secure development practices, manage security testing and remediation, and ensure suppliers and integrations meet our security requirements. This is a highly cross-functional role where you will coordinate security activities across multiple stakeholders and drive improvements in processes, tooling, and security maturity.

Job Responsibilities: Enterprise Vulnerabilities
  • Own and develop our enterprise vulnerability management capabilities, including vulnerability tooling, scanning, data integrations, reporting, and integration with SDLC, DevSecOps, and CI/CD processes.

  • Work with Risk and technical teams to identify and prioritise vulnerabilities, define remediation plans, track key risk and performance indicators, and coordinate remediation across the organisation.

Third-Party Security & Supply Chain Security
  • Lead third-party and supply chain security, including supplier risk assessments, security due diligence and continuous monitoring, as well as software supply chain practices such as SBOM governance and open-source risk management.
  • Penetration Testing & Red Team Services
  • Lead penetration testing and Red Team activities, ensuring testing reflects business risks and relevant threats, and coordinate remediation and retesting of identified vulnerabilities.
  • Code Signing Services:
  • Support code-signing services and governance, ensuring secure certificate and key management, software integrity, and trusted release processes across development teams.
  • Qualifications:

    • 10+ years of cybersecurity experience, including 5+ years in a senior or leading role within application security, vulnerability management, or security assurance.

    • Strong experience with enterprise vulnerability management and application security, including penetration testing and third-party/supplier security.

    • Hands-on experience implementing DevSecOps and secure software development practices, including security integration within CI/CD environments.

    • Good understanding of relevant security frameworks, testing methodologies, and technologies, such as OWASP, NIST, SAST/DAST/SCA, API and cloud security, software supply chain security, and PKI/code signing.

    • Experience working with cloud environments such as Azure, AWS, or GCP. Relevant certifications such as CISSP, CSSLP, OSCP, or GIAC are an advantage.

    AutoStore™ holds a simple yet powerful vision: to store and move things for everyone, everywhere. Founded in Norway, we've grown into a global technology company. AutoStore uses advanced software to automate and orchestrate order fulfillment.

    Our goal is to ensure orders arrive faster than ever, with minimal environmental impact. That’s how we help brands exceed customer expectations. We have more than 1600 systems in nearly 60 countries, and we grow continuously as a community of employees, partners, customers, suppliers, and connected technologies.

    Automation should make life easier, and by listening carefully to our community, we innovate to meet the industry’s most complex needs. With AutoStore™, brands gain speed, efficiency, and improved workplaces. And much more floor space.
